Optimizing Properties for MI

Possession management is possibly the most visible part of sustainable web style. In 2026, the usage of heavy video backgrounds and uncompressed imagery is viewed as an indication of poor craftsmanship. Instead, designers are using contemporary formats like AVIF for images and specialized compression algorithms that preserve visual fidelity at a fraction of the file size. Beyond just images, the choice of typography plays a part in sustainability. System font styles, which are currently set up on a user's gadget, need no data transfer. When custom-made branding is necessary, variable fonts allow a single file to contain multiple weights and designs, lowering the variety of HTTP demands. These little technical choices, when scaled throughout a website with millions of views, result in huge energy cost savings.

The Shift Toward Edge Computing and Green Hosting

The infrastructure behind the code is simply as important as the code itself. In 2026, the shift toward edge computing has localized data processing, indicating data journeys much shorter distances from the server to the user. This reduction in range decreases the energy lost during transmission. Coding Standards and Dark Mode by Default

One of the most basic yet most reliable ways to save energy on the end-user side is the application of dark mode. On OLED and AMOLED screens, which are basic for a lot of mobile phones in 2026, black pixels are basically turned off, consuming substantially less battery power. Creating with a "dark-first" mentality is a hallmark of the current sustainable web motion.
